My DS's 6th birthday falls on Sunday 5th January, which just so happens to be the last day of the school Christmas holidays.

Thinking of throwing a smallish party at a local soft play.

Just wondering, whether it would be best to go ahead on the day or wait another week and throw the party once kids have been back at school for a bit.

I'd wait a week personally. That way you have a week to remind people and chase rsvps. A party invite given out before the holidays is likely to be forgotten about in amongst all the Christmas holiday chaos.

Alstation · 23/11/2024 16:12

It's tricky to do the comms unless you are already friendly with the parents. People won't like to commit to that weekend before Christmas, and it's tricky to chase them up over Christmas hols. I would wait a week.

MumonabikeE5 · 23/11/2024 16:20

I’d ask his 3/4 key friends if they can make the 5th, and if they can I’d extend the invitation formally to the rest of the group. If the key pals can’t come I’d change the date.
